BPC-157 is a synthetic pentadecapeptide (a peptide made up of 15 amino acids) based on a segment from a natural peptide (BPC) derived from human gastric juice.3 4 Insider Tip: Other names for BPC-157 are body protection compound 157, BPC-15, bepecin, PLD-116, PL-10, and PL-14736. Some also refer to BPC-157 as the Wolverine peptide due to its potential to support healing
